A JobOpps account will link you to opportunities within local government in Mobile County. It is as simple as 1, 2, 3 ...

  1. PREPARE AHEAD
    To set up your account, you will be asked for complete information about your education and work history (i.e. employers, dates, addresses, etc.). Entry time is limited. STOP and gather information before you begin. Collect any related documents, such as your driver's license, college transcripts and certifications. These documents may be scanned when establishing your account.

  2. EMAIL ACCESS
    You will need an email address to begin your JobOpps account. The email address will allow you to access your account, learn about job opportunities and receive future communications from us. If you do not already have an email address, free email accounts are available through a number of internet providers. The Mobile County Personnel Board cannot endorse any particular provider, but examples of free email providers include: Google, Inbox, Microsoft and Yahoo.
    NOTE: You cannot share email addresses with anyone else. Each individual applicant must have a unique Username and Password and email address.

  3. ACCOUNT SET-UP
    Follow this link to create an account. An Online Employment Application Guide is available to provide instructions. You will be asked to enter a USERNAME and PASSWORD of your choosing. Please make sure to record and retain this information for future reference.
